DEFENSIVE AREAS

SEVERAL ON AMERICAN COAST (Rec. 9 p.m.) WASHINGTON, Dec. 12. Eight defensive areas on the west and east ‘ coasts, in which' vessels except those operating under navy orders can enter only after obtaining specific authorisation, have been established by an executive order signed by President Roosevelt. Such areas will be mined and otherwise protected. The areas are Portland. Portsmouth, Boston, Narragansett Bay, San Diego, the Columbia River entrance, the Strait of San Juan, and Puget.
